Output 63a6b080de32903a7f0bcd29c06ffb5d4b439f56ce6611fdac2a1f1a314308fb:1

value
27872752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e6490a816b67022d1a17ea9c914fcef8014942 OP_EQUAL
address
37t34uCBnzvZWJStmCfJbQzQryJuGBf4Yk
transaction
63a6b080de32903a7f0bcd29c06ffb5d4b439f56ce6611fdac2a1f1a314308fb
confirmations
497373
spent
true